Get the doctor’s attention — for a fee

Rising costs, crowded waiting rooms and decreasing access to doctors are among the reasons medical patients in Southern California and across the nation use words like \”headache\” and \”frustration\” to describe America\’s health care system. And with declining insurance reimbursements, rising malpractice premiums, claims frustrations and growing paperwork, individual practitioners are often forced to increase the volume of patients they see as they decrease time spent in the examination room.

The Persian rabbi explains it all

Haji Hayim sings and dances to a traditional song typically sung at b\’nai mitzvah ceremonies, but he does so to a techno beat. The cartoon character started grabbing the attention of the Iranian Jewish community in January 2006, when his video was distributed in e-mails as part of the official launch of Persianrabbi.com, the brainchild of 23-year-old product developer and community leader Eman Chayim Esmailzadeh.

The Jewish accent’s on France at FeujLA

With a name derived from the slang word feuj — for Jew — with L.A. tagged on, this hip crowd of young French and some Francophiles came together to catch up with friends, meet new people and listen to and perform favorite Hebrew and Jewish songs.
